Domanda

Sto costruendo un applicazione PHP in cui l'utente caricare file Powerpoint. Voglio che gli altri utenti di visualizzare on-line, invece di download. (Utilizzando un terzo apps parti come google docs potrebbe essere un po 'ingombrante per gli utenti) E' possibile scrivere un codice di Visualizzatore di PowerPoint in PHP?

È stato utile?

Soluzione

Si potrebbe automatizzare il processo di utilizzo di google docs con PHP.

Google fornisce un visualizzatore PPT che può essere incorporare nelle pagine web utilizzando il seguente codice

<iframe src="http://docs.google.com/gview?url=http://www.domainname.come/presentation.ppt&embedded=true" style="width:550px; height:450px;" frameborder="0"></iframe>

Ora im assumendo maniglie php gli arrivi utenti fanno, quindi sarebbe facile da trovare l'URL del file specifico ppt. È possibile memorizzare l'URL sia in una variabile o un database, prendere quando necessario e inserirlo nel codice di cui sopra.

Spero di essere stato in grado di spiegare la logica im cercando di applicare, non fatemi sapere se avete bisogno di più specifiche.

Altri suggerimenti

Ho il sospetto che sarebbe molto più facile per ridurre le diapositive PowerPoint in file .PNG, e costruire un semplice script PHP per scorrere le immagini.

Si vuole ri-scrittura Powerpoint in PHP? Che sto per dire ... molto difficile al meglio. Vi sono, tuttavia, gli strumenti là fuori che rendono la vita più facile. Inoltre, c'è un opzione "Salva come pagina Web" in Powerpoint, così forse si potrebbe avere i vostri uploader Salvare il PowerPoint come una pagina web, e caricare che la produzione, che immagino sarebbe stato abbastanza facile per voi a mettere successivamente sul web.

In alternativa, se vi sentite più ambizioso, si poteva leggere sulla documentazione API di Google, ed eventualmente creare un portale per caricare su Google Documenti per i contribuenti, e visualizzare Google Documenti per i tuoi visitatori. Il tuo frontend PHP potrebbe sfruttare la potenza di Google Docs, ma eliminare la pesantezza (Sono un po 'sorpreso dal fatto che è una parola vera).

"E 'possibile scrivere un codice di Visualizzatore di PowerPoint in PHP?"

Sì. Purtroppo, se ti stai chiedendo a questa domanda, probabilmente non sarà in grado di farlo da soli.

Se volete provare in ogni modo, ecco un buon posto per iniziare: http://msdn.microsoft.com/en-us /library/cc313106(office.12).aspx

In alternativa si può cercare una libreria che fa. Sono probabilmente là fuori, solo Google esso.

EDIT: Trovato uno qui: http://phppowerpoint.codeplex.com/

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top